SR603-Flowbee Posted April 6, 2021 Posted April 6, 2021 (edited) Walter Nowotny (7 December 1920 – 8 November 1944) was an Austrian-born fighter ace of the Luftwaffe in World War II. He is credited with 258 aerial victories—that is, 258 aerial combat encounters resulting in the destruction of the enemy aircraft—in 442 combat missions. Nowotny achieved 255 of these victories on the Eastern Front and three while flying one of the first jet fighters, the Messerschmitt Me 262, in the Defense of the Reich. He scored most of his victories in the Focke-Wulf Fw 190, and approximately 50 in the Messerschmitt Bf109. Nowotny scored an "ace in a day" on multiple occasions, shooting down at least five airplanes on the same day, including two occurrences of "double-ace in a day" (scored at least ten kills) in the summer of 1943. 8 November 1944, news reached the command post of a large bomber formation approaching. Two Rotten of Me 262 were prepared for take-off, Erich Büttner and Franz Schall at Hesepe, and Nowotny and Günther Wegmann at Achmer. At first only Schall and Wegmann managed to take off because Büttner had a punctured tire during taxiing and Nowotny's turbines initially refused to start. With some delay, Nowotny took off and engaged the enemy on his own, Schall and Wegmann having since retired from the action after sustaining battle damage. Nowotny radioed that he had downed a B-24 Liberator and a P-51 Mustang before he reported one engine failing and made one final garbled transmission containing the word "burning". Helmut Lennartz recalled: "I remember Nowotny's crash very well. Feldwebel Gossler, a radio operator with our unit, had set up a radio on the airfield. Over this set I and many others listened to the radio communications with Nowotny's aircraft. His last words were, "I'm on fire" or "it's on fire". The words were slightly garbled. Unlike other famous Luftwaffe aces such as Adolf Galland and Hans-Joachim Marseille, Nowotny’s military career started after the beginning of WWII, in October 1939. As part of his training, he was posted to Jagdfliegerschule 5, which Marseille had attended previously. While there, he befriended Paul Galland, the younger brother of Adolf Galland. One of his instructors there was Julius Arigi, Austria-Hungary’s second most successful WWI fighter ace. It was not until July 1941 that Nowotny scored his first two victories in the same fight, shooting down two I-153s over Estonia. Despite being most commonly associated with Germany’s more advanced fighters, the Fw-190 and Me-262, Nowotny’s first success was actually in a Bf-109 E-7. He nearly didn’t survive his first successes, however, as he was shot down by another I-153 flown by Soviet ace Aleksandr Avdeyev, who would be killed just over a year later. Nowotny spent 3 days on a dinghy in the Baltic, reportedly almost being rammed by a Soviet destroyer, before he came ashore and could return to his unit. 2
